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of GeForce GT 745A and GeForce RTX 2060

NVIDIA

GeForce GT 745A

The GeForce GT 745A is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in August 26 2013. It features the Kepler architecture. The core clock ranges from 837 MHz to 915 MHz. It has 384 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 33W. Manufactured using 28 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 1,234 points.

NVIDIA

GeForce RTX 2060

The GeForce RTX 2060 is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in January 7 2019. It features the Turing architecture. The core clock ranges from 1365 MHz to 1680 MHz. It has 1920 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 160W. Manufactured using 12 nm process technology. It features 30 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 14,114 points. Launch price was $349.

Video Memory (VRAM)

The GeForce GT 745A comes with 512 MB of VRAM, while the GeForce RTX 2060 has 6 GB. The GeForce RTX 2060 offers 1100% more capacity, crucial for higher resolutions and texture-heavy games. Bus width: 64-bit vs 192-bit. L2 Cache: 0.25 MB (GeForce GT 745A) vs 3 MB (GeForce RTX 2060) — the GeForce RTX 2060 has significantly larger on-die cache to reduce VRAM reliance.

Media & Encoding

Hardware encoder: NVENC (1st Gen) (GeForce GT 745A) vs NVENC (Turing) (GeForce RTX 2060). Decoder: PureVideo HD VP5 vs NVDEC (Turing). Supported codecs: H.264,VC-1,MPEG-2 (GeForce GT 745A) vs H.264,H.265,VP9,VP8,MPEG-2,VC-1 (GeForce RTX 2060).
